NH Locations Abbreviation

NH has various meanings in the Locations category. Discover the full forms, definitions, and usage contexts of NH in Locations.

Vanuatu

Most Common Locations
Nacional Hoteo
Locations
Night Hotels
Locations
Naga Hoho
Locations
National Highways
Locations
Near Hotel
Locations
New Hampsire
Locations
North-Holland
Locations
Numancia Hotel
Locations

Citation

Last updated: